Curbing Installation in Citrus County, FL
Curbing installation services involve the construction and placement of borders along driveways, walkways, lawns, and garden beds to define property boundaries and enhance curb appeal. These projects typically include installing concrete, brick, stone, or other durable materials to create clean, functional edges that help contain landscaping elements and prevent soil or mulch from spilling onto walkways or driveways. Homeowners often seek curb installation to improve the appearance of their property, add structure to landscaping, or increase safety by clearly marking pathways and boundaries.
Before requesting curb installation services, property owners should consider the desired material, style, and overall look they want to achieve.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the length and height of the curb, as well as any drainage considerations or existing landscape features. Having a clear idea of these details can assist in planning a curb that complements the property’s design while meeting practical needs.

Common Curbing Installation Jobs
Concrete Curbing - adds defined borders around flower beds and walkways for a clean look.
Stone Curbing - provides durable edging options using natural or manufactured stone materials.
Brick Curbing - creates classic, decorative borders that enhance landscape design.
Plastic or Vinyl Curbing - offers flexible, low-maintenance edging solutions suitable for various garden styles.
Custom Curbing - allows for tailored designs to complement unique property landscapes.
Retaining Wall Edging - stabilizes soil and defines levels in sloped yard areas.
Curbing Installation Questions
What types of materials are used for curbing installation? Common materials include concrete, stone, and brick, chosen for durability and style options.
Can curbing be installed around garden beds? Yes, curbing is often installed along garden beds to define spaces and prevent mulch or soil from spreading.
Is curbing suitable for driveways or walkways? Curbing can be used to outline driveways and walkways, providing a clean, finished appearance.
What considerations should be made before installing curbing? Property layout, desired style, and existing landscaping are important factors to plan for a proper installation.
